Here's a postcard showing a view I don't remember seeing before. It's looking down New High Street towards Court Street with the tower of the Times Building in the background.
The seller dates it at 1908.
eBay
This is how the area appears on the 1910 Baist map.

below: Looking down New High street toward Franklin St.
detail
-the above view is from this photograph.
old file of mine dated 2012 (I always meant to post this but never did)
notice the "San Diego Beer" blade sign on the corner...as well as a sign advertising "Oak Bar". I'm unsure about the cut-off building plaque K R OK L.
-and if you look closely, there is a WELCOME sign on the courthouse tower.
-a glimpse of several buildings on the opposite side of the courthouse (on Broadway). -also, note the "New" sign on the utility pole at far right (for New High Street)
a detail of the steps, with Celtic-looking ornament engraved in stone. (oh, and two lions)
